# Disabling laptop dGPUs
|
||||
|
||||
So with laptops, we can hide the dGPU from macOS with the little boot-arg called `-wegnoegpu` from WhateverGreen. But one small problem, the dGPU is still pulling power draining your battery slowly. We'll be going over 2 methods for disabling the dGPU in a laptop:
|
||||
|
||||
* [Optimus Method](/Laptops/laptop-disable.md#optimus-method)
|
||||
* [Bumblebee Method](/Laptops/laptop-disable.md#bumblebee-method)
|
||||
|
||||
## Optimus Method
|
||||
|
||||
How this works is that we call the `.off` method found on Optimus GPUs, this is the expected way to power off a GPU but some may find their dGPU will power back up later on. Mainly seen in Lenovo's, the Optimus method should work for most users:
|
||||
|
||||
To start, grab [SSDT-dGPU-Off.dsl](https://github.com/khronokernel/Getting-Started-With-ACPI/blob/master/extra-files/SSDT-dGPU-Off.dsl.zip)
|
||||
|
||||
|
||||
Next we need to get on Windows, and head to the following:
|
||||
|
||||
```text
|
||||
Device Manager -> Display Adapters -> dGPU -> Properties -> Details > BIOS device name
|
||||
```
|
||||
|
||||
This should provided you with an ACPI path for your dGPU, most commonly:
|
||||
|
||||
* Nvidia dGPU: `\_SB.PCI0.PEG0.PEGP`
|
||||
* AMD dGPU: `\_SB.PCI0.PEGP.DGFX`
|
||||
|
||||
Now with that, we'll need to change the ACPI path in the SSDT. Main sections:
|
||||
|
||||
```text
|
||||
External(_SB.PCI0.PEG0.PEGP._OFF, MethodObj) // ACPI Path of dGPU
|
||||
```text
|
||||
|
||||
```text
|
||||
If (CondRefOf(\_SB.PCI0.PEG0.PEGP._OFF)) { \_SB.PCI0.PEG0.PEGP._OFF() }
|
||||
```
|
||||
|
||||
Once adapted to your config, head to the compile section

## Bumblebee Method
|
||||
|
||||
With some machines, the simple `.off` call won't keep the card off properly, that's where the Bumblebee method comes in. This SSDT will actually send the dGPU into D3 state being the lowest power state a device can support. Creit to Mameo for the original adaptation
|
||||
|
||||
To start, grab [SSDT-NoHybGfx.dsl](https://github.com/khronokernel/Getting-Started-With-ACPI/blob/master/extra-files/SSDT-NoHybGfx.dsl.zip)
|
||||
|
||||
Next we need to get on Windows, and head to the following:
|
||||
|
||||
```text
|
||||
Device Manager -> Display Adapters -> dGPU -> Properties -> Details > BIOS device name
|
||||
```
|
||||
|
||||
This should provided you with an ACPI path for your dGPU, most commonly:
|
||||
|
||||
* Nvidia dGPU: `\_SB.PCI0.PEG0.PEGP`
|
||||
* AMD dGPU: `\_SB.PCI0.PEGP.DGFX`
|
||||
|
||||
Now with that, we'll need to change the ACPI path in the SSDT. Main sections:
|
||||
|
||||
```text
|
||||
External (_SB_.PCI0.PEG0.PEGP._DSM, MethodObj) // dGPU ACPI Path
|
||||
External (_SB_.PCI0.PEG0.PEGP._PS3, MethodObj) // dGPU ACPI Path
|
||||
```
|
||||
|
||||
```text
|
||||
If ((CondRefOf (\_SB.PCI0.PEG0.PEGP._DSM) && CondRefOf (\_SB.PCI0.PEG0.PEGP._PS3)))
|
||||
{
|
||||
// Card Off Request
|
||||
\_SB.PCI0.PEG0.PEGP._DSM (ToUUID ("a486d8f8-0bda-471b-a72b-6042a6b5bee0"), 0x0100, 0x1A, Buffer (0x04)
|
||||
{
|
||||
0x01, 0x00, 0x00, 0x03
|
||||
})
|
||||
// Card Off
|
||||
\_SB.PCI0.PEG0.PEGP._PS3 ()
|
||||
}
|
||||
```
|
||||
|
||||
Once adapted to your config, head to the compile section
